Understanding the Mechanics of Plinko
At its core, Plinko is a game of probability. The path a puck takes is determined by a series of random bounces as it descends through the peg field. Each peg presents a 50/50 chance of deflecting the puck either left or right. However, the sheer number of pegs means that the eventual outcome is largely unpredictable. Online versions often incorporate random number generators (RNGs) to ensure fairness and impartiality. The prize slots at the bottom typically offer varying amounts, with higher payouts in more difficult-to-reach locations.

The Role of Probability and Randomness
The foundation of the plinko game lies in the principles of probability. While each peg interaction presents a 50/50 split, the cumulative effect of many interactions leads to an approximate normal distribution of outcomes. This means that, over a large number of plays, pucks are statistically more likely to land in the central prize slots. It’s essential to remember that each game is independent of the last; past results do not influence future outcomes.

Understanding Variance and Risk Tolerance
The variability of outcomes, known as variance, is a key concept in Plinko. High variance means that wins are infrequent but potentially large, while low variance signifies more frequent but smaller wins. Your tolerance for risk should influence your betting strategy. Players comfortable with higher risk might opt for larger bets and focus on higher payout slots, while risk-averse players might prefer smaller bets and more consistent, albeit modest, wins.
